Cape Verde’s 2026 World Cup debut keeps delivering surprises. The “Blue Sharks” drew 0-0 with Spain and then posted a 2-2 draw versus Uruguay, making them the first debutant side to remain unbeaten in its opening two matches since Senegal in 2002. Key figures: goals by Kevin Pina and Hélio Varela, with goalkeeper Vozinha highlighted for standout saves. Coach Bubista frames the run as inspiration for smaller nations. Next match: Cape Verde play Saudi Arabia on June 26. A win “almost certainly” advances them, while a draw could still be enough depending on results in the expanded 48-team format. Crypto angle: attention has spilled into “unofficial memecoins” on DEXs tied to Vozinha and Cape Verde. The article stresses these tokens have no official connection to the players, the team, or FIFA. Separately, FIFA’s structured crypto moves include: - Avalanche for World Cup ticketing and digital collectibles (blockchain used for authenticity and access rights) - Kraken as the tournament’s official crypto exchange partner (designated June 9) For traders, the key theme is memecoin-driven hype around a mainstream sports storyline, alongside FIFA’s more credible “World Cup crypto” partnerships that could reinforce broader attention to crypto rails in the long run.

Unofficial memecoin launches often create short-lived trading spikes, but the article explicitly notes there’s no official link to FIFA, players, or the team. That typically limits sustained fundamental value, keeping impact closer to a sentiment/flow event than a durable catalyst. On the other hand, FIFA’s partnerships are more credible: Avalanche is used for ticketing/digital collectibles, and Kraken is a named exchange partner. Historically, major-brand sports/entertainment crypto integrations can lift broad awareness and sometimes support higher spot activity for the involved ecosystem, but they rarely move prices materially by themselves unless accompanied by product adoption data or token-specific incentives. So the likely effect is: - Short term: mild volatility and retail-driven demand in related memecoin markets. - Long term: gradual positive narrative for “sports + crypto infrastructure,” without a direct, immediate supply/demand shock to large-cap coins. Overall, traders should expect attention-driven bursts rather than a clear directional macro market signal.
